PURPOSE:To perform parallel operation by controlling the oscillation frequency of an oscillating means based on a phase difference voltage corresponding to the phase difference between AC output voltage and current so that the phase difference will be zero. CONSTITUTION:A phase detector 16 outputs a phase difference voltage corresponding to the phase difference between signals (b), (b') to a VCO 6 and controls the oscillation frequency thereof. Frequency controlled output oscillation signal from the VCO 6 is subjected to frequency division through a frequency divider and fed, as a clock signal, to a sine wave forming circuit 8. The sine wave forming circuit 8 generates a stepping sine wave signal based on the clock signal and thus generated sine wave signal is fed to an electronic volume 9. The electronic volume 9 controls blocking/passage of the sine wave and the attenuation thereof at the time of passage and thus controlled sine wave is then fed through an LPF 10 to a PWM 11 which produces a pulse subjected to PWM modulation by the sine wave signal. Consequently, no special scheme is required at the time of parallel operation. |
